Toyota Urban Cruiser Ebella: Expected Price, Features and Battery Details Revealed

The Toyota Urban Cruiser Ebella marks Toyota’s entry into the Indian electric vehicle market, serving as a premium sibling to the recently launched Maruti Suzuki e Vitara. Following the announcement of the e Vitara’s prices, anticipation is high for the Urban Cruiser Ebella’s official pricing reveal, expected soon. This midsize electric SUV promises a blend of efficient powertrains, long range, and a host of premium features tailored for urban and highway use.

Toyota has not yet officially announced the prices for the Urban Cruiser Ebella, but industry estimates place it in the competitive mid-size EV segment. Based on expert analyses and comparisons with its Maruti counterpart (which starts around ₹15.99 lakh ex-showroom for battery-inclusive variants), the Urban Cruiser Ebella is widely expected to command a slight premium due to Toyota branding, additional refinements, and select exclusive features.Anticipated ex-showroom prices (in ₹ lakh):

  • Base variant (E1, 49 kWh): Around ₹17 lakh
  • Mid variant (E2, 61 kWh): Around ₹19.5 lakh
  • Top variant (E3, 61 kWh): Around ₹21 lakh (some sources suggest up to ₹24 lakh for fully loaded trims)

These figures position it against rivals like the Hyundai Creta EV, Tata Curvv EV, and MG ZS EV. Toyota also offers customer-friendly options, including an 8-year battery warranty, a 60% buyback assurance, and a potential Battery-as-a-Service (BaaS) program to lower upfront costs—similar to the e Vitara’s model starting at ₹10.99 lakh plus per-km battery rental.Prices are tentative and could vary upon official announcement, expected in the coming weeks, with the full launch slated for February 2026.

Powertrain and Performance

The Urban Cruiser Ebella is built on a dedicated EV platform and features front-wheel-drive with two lithium-iron-phosphate (LFP) battery pack options paired with front-axle electric motors. LFP batteries are known for durability, safety, and longevity.

  • 49 kWh battery pack (entry-level E1 variant):
    • Power: Approximately 142 bhp (106 kW)
    • Torque: 189 Nm
    • ARAI-certified range: Up to 440 km
    • Ideal for city commuters seeking affordability and sufficient daily range
  • 61 kWh battery pack (higher E2 and E3 variants):
    • Power: Approximately 171.5–174 bhp (128 kW)
    • Torque: 189 Nm
    • ARAI-certified range: Up to 543 km
    • Better suited for longer drives with stronger performance

Both setups deliver instant torque for responsive acceleration, smooth one-pedal driving via adjustable regenerative braking, and efficient energy use. DC fast charging support (up to 150 kW) enables quick top-ups, making it practical for road trips.

Premium Features and Interior

Toyota emphasizes comfort, safety, and technology in the Urban Cruiser Ebella, positioning it as a premium offering in its class.Key highlights include:

  • Safety: Seven airbags, Level-2 ADAS (adaptive cruise control, lane keep assist, automatic emergency braking, and more—likely on top variants), 360-degree camera, and electronic parking brake.
  • Comfort and Convenience: Ventilated front seats, electrically adjustable driver’s seat (up to 10-way), sliding and reclining rear seats for enhanced passenger space, dual-screen setup (10.1-inch digital driver’s display + 10.25-inch infotainment touchscreen), wireless Android Auto/Apple CarPlay, connected car tech, PM 2.5 air filter, and noise/IR-reducing front windshield.
  • Audio and Ambience: Premium JBL sound system with woofer for immersive audio.
  • Exterior and Practicality: Modern SUV styling with Toyota-specific design cues (distinct from the e Vitara), 18-inch wheels, LED lighting, and a claimed turning radius of 5.2 meters for easy urban maneuverability.

Why It Stands Out

As Toyota’s first EV in India, the Urban Cruiser Ebella benefits from the brand’s reputation for reliability and after-sales support. Sharing underpinnings with the Maruti e Vitara allows cost efficiencies while Toyota adds its touch through enhanced features, build quality, and ownership perks like extended battery assurance.With growing EV adoption in India, this SUV targets buyers seeking a practical, feature-packed electric crossover without compromising on range or refinement.
